Easy Nuclear Power Plant Diagram File Nuclear Power Plant Pwr Diagram Coal, petroleum, natural gas and hydroelectricity have each caused more fatalities per unit of energy due to air pollution and accidents. nuclear power plants also emit no greenhouse gases and result in less life cycle carbon emissions than common sources of renewable energy. Nuclear energy provides electricity without releasing greenhouse gases or air pollution. nuclear energy is reliable and produces electricity no matter the time of the day or the weather. In a nuclear power plant, uranium is the material used in the fission process. the heat from fission boils water and creates steam to turn a turbine. as the turbine spins, the generator turns and its magnetic field produces electricity. They contain and control nuclear chain reactions that produce heat through a physical process called fission. that heat is used to make steam that spins a turbine to create electricity.
